Our first stop was the charming town of Killorglin, where we learned about the legendary Puck Fair. This ancient festival, where a wild goat is crowned king, captivated the kids’ imaginations and set the tone for a day filled with stories and history. Immersive History at Kerry Bog Village

The Kerry Bog Village Museum was a highlight for our family, offering a glimpse into rural Irish life during the 18th and 19th centuries. The kids were fascinated by the thatched cottages and the authentic antiques that filled each room. As a museum curator, I appreciated the attention to detail and the effort to preserve this slice of history. The sound effects and figurines brought the past to life, making it an educational experience that was both fun and informative.

Denis’s knowledge of the area was impressive, and his stories about the Kerry Bog Pony, a breed nearly lost to history, added depth to our visit. Despite the rain, the village was bustling with activity, and the kids enjoyed exploring the farm equipment and learning about the lives of turf cutters and farmers. The Majestic Kerry Cliffs

As we approached the Kerry Cliffs, the weather took a turn for the worse, with wind and rain lashing against the bus. Yet, Denis’s enthusiasm never waned. He played traditional Irish music, creating a soundtrack that perfectly matched the dramatic landscape unfolding before us. The cliffs, standing over 1,000 feet above the Atlantic, were a sight to behold, even through the mist.

The viewing platform offered breathtaking views of the Skellig Islands and the rugged coastline. The kids, bundled up against the elements, were awestruck by the sheer scale and beauty of the cliffs. It was a moment of pure wonder, a reminder of nature’s power and majesty. Despite the challenging weather, the experience was unforgettable, and Denis’s humor and warmth made it all the more special.

Our journey continued through picturesque towns like Cahersiveen and Waterville, where we paused to admire the Charlie Chaplin Statue.
